How to Make The Perfect Banana Pudding
This is the recipe for creamy banana goodness you've been waiting for. Crispy wafers and banana pudding come together in a delicious treat inspired by the Magnolia Bakery.
Prep Time
15 mins
Total Time
15 mins
Servings: 12
Calories: 451 kcal
Course:
Dessert
Cuisine:
American
Ingredients
- 2 cups low-fat milk
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 2 packets instant vanilla pudding
- 1 can sweetened condensed milk 14 ounces
- 2 cups whipping cream
- 1 packet vanilla wafers 11 ounces
- 6 Fresh Bananas
Instructions
- Pour the milk, vanilla extract, and instant pudding into a large bowl and whisk until well combined, about 2 minutes. Set aside.
- Use an electric whisk to whip the cream into stiff peaks.
- Peel and slice the bananas. Reserve one banana for decorating the top of your pudding.
- Line the bottom of the bowl with one-quarter of the wafers. Spoon on a layer of instant pudding, then whipped cream, and then bananas. Repeat these 4 layers until you have filled your bowl. Then decorate the top if you'd like, and serve.
